Maintenance Strategy and PM Insights: See Where You Stand and What’s Next
On-demand
Get a maintenance strategy overview in Microsoft Dynamics 365 Supply Chain Management. See where your assets fall across Preventive, Predictive, Reactive, and Run-to-Failure (if that counts as a strategy), and compare corrective vs. preventive workloads with built-in KPIs.
Drill down to the asset level with PM insights such as next scheduled job, last completed PM, and plan effectiveness, so you can quickly spot and fix issues like missing future dates or discarded lines.
We’ll also share highlights from the latest release that make strategy validation and PM reviews even easier.
